Description
Discusses the issues associated with the exodus of Jews from Arab lands and the flight of Arabs from Israel. Unlike other countries that received these refugees,in most of the Arab countries, strenuous efforts were made to prevent or to limit the re-settlement of their Palestinian refugees. Arab leaders have denounced and thwarted all international attempts to re-settle the refugees in empty lands away from Israel’s borders for political reasons.
